Section 15 TSG2 (TSG20)
(3)
Control Methods in 120-DC Mode
Control methods in 120-DC mode are listed below.
Setting software
output control
method
Setting TSnOPT0.TSnSTE = 0 switches the output pattern by software output
control. The TSG2nO1 to TSG2nO6 pin output is switched according to
TSnOPT1.TSnSPC2 to TSnSPC0.
The output order at the beginning of operation is set with TSnOPT0.TSnIDC.
The output pattern is set with TSnOPT0.TSnPSC.
Operation of
software output
control method
The PWM output of TSG2nO1 to TSG2nO6 pins (PWM output defined by
TSnCMP1 to TSnCMP12) is selected by TSnOPT1.TSnSPC2 to TSnSPC0 by
software. To control the dead time, the dead time counter is activated at the
falling edge of the signals in each phase and the dead time is inserted.
The 16-bit counter counts based on the carrier period set in TSnCMP0. The
16-bit counter is cleared by match of the 16-bit counter and TSnCMP0 or by a
write access to TSnOPT1.TSnSPC2 to TSnSPC0.
In this method, the pattern is output, which is decoded using information on the
output pattern (TSnSPC2 to TSnSPC0), the electric current direction control bit
(TSnOPT0.TSnIDC), and TSG2nPTSI2 to TSG2nPTSI0 pattern order
detection flag (TSnSTR1.TSnTSF). Figure 15-83 shows the timer output when
the output pattern is changed by software output control.
Immediately after the operation starts (TSnTRG0.TSnTS = 1), the output
pattern of TSnSPC2 to TSnSPC0 and the pattern set with TSnIDC and
TSnPSC (TSnOPT0.TSnPSS = 1) are output.
Control Method
Function
Software output control
method
Switches the output pattern according to the
TSnOPT1.TSnSPC2 to TSnSPC0 setting made by software.
Pattern switch method
Directly switches the output pattern by the pattern input signal
of TSG2nPTSI0 to TSG2nPTSI2.
Trigger switch method
Switches the output pattern by the trigger switch method using
the trigger input signals TSnOPCI0 and TSnOPCI1 or by the
pattern input setting of TSnOPT1.TSnSPC2 to TSnSPC0 in
the constant order.
